John boarded the bus from Sydney to Canberra. The journey started quite normally. He packed his bag, sat on the seat, and took a deep breath. Long journey fatigue was clear in his eyes and face. Just then, the phone rang. It was his wife on the other end. After a few minutes of conversation, it was clear that the family was fairly stable and normal. His wife asked carefully, "Have you eaten? Are you okay?" John assured him that everything was fine.

As soon as he called, a girl came and sat on the seat next to her. She was not very old, about twenty-five. Although it started with simple politeness and conversation at first, at the end of the three-hour journey, their conversation seemed to reach a strange place. Laughter, stories, and a kind of unfamiliar attraction—all of it created a dilemma in John's mind.
Although he loved his wife, this sudden attraction stirred something different inside him. The simple smile, curious questions, and lively nature of this girl named Tina surprised him. For a moment, it seemed that this trip might have been boring if Tina hadn't come. But at the same time, it seemed like she was crossing a line?
When they arrived in Canberra, Tina held his hand with a smile. At the moment of farewell, she slipped a business card into John's hand in a very casual manner. That small gesture caused a strong wave in his mind. As he got off the bus, he wondered - was I just looking for a little extra company to forget the fatigue of the journey, or was I really falling into a temptation?
John had two roads in front of him at that time. On one side was family, responsibility and self-respect. On the other side was a new attraction, forbidden but exciting. Fear was also at work inside him. If he makes a wrong decision, confidence in the relationship will be broken. But it was also difficult to deny that Tina's smile left a deep impression on her mind.
In the end, John put the card in his pocket but did not make any calls. After leaving the bus stop, he realized that this small incident had helped him recognize his inner weakness. Temptation will come; it is natural to stop, but accepting it means betrayal.
When he got to the hotel and opened his bag, he suddenly noticed that the card Tina gave him was not actually a visiting card, but a small note. It was written on it—
Take care of yourself. You are tired, so I wanted to make you happy. nothing more."
John paused for a moment. The turmoil, guilt, and hesitation that had been building in his mind suddenly became easier. He realized that maybe Tina had not tested him incorrectly, but rather he himself was fighting the temptation within himself.

Looking out the hotel window, he sighed. The Canberra sky reminded him anew—the real battle of man is not with the outside world, but with the weakness of his own heart. And winning that fight is true courage.
